The fungi kingdom contains non-photosynthetic multicellular organisms that digest their food externally. Examples of fungi are yeasts, smuts, molds and mushrooms
The kingdom that includes complex multicellular organisms that obtain food by breaking down other substances in their surroundings is Fungi. Fungi are heterotrophic organisms that absorb nutrients from their environment through extracellular digestion.

An organism that is multicellular, cannot photosynthesize, and contains DNA in a nucleus belongs to the Kingdom Animalia. This kingdom includes all animals, which are heterotrophic, meaning they obtain their food by consuming other organisms. Unlike plants or some protists, animals lack the ability to perform photosynthesis. Additionally, their cells are eukaryotic, characterized by the presence of a nucleus containing DNA.
